Get Outside

With the Colorado River basically in our backyard, it’s no surprise that Bastrop boasts absolutely stunning outdoor scenery, especially in the springtime. Take advantage of a sunny afternoon and tee off at any of the excellent golf courses available, such as the Lost Pines Golf Club, which features a championship golf course designed by world-renowned architect Arthur Hills. If you’d rather get up close and personal to the beautiful Texas wilderness, there are plenty of hiking opportunities for hikers of all levels. Spend an afternoon working up a sweat on the trails at Bastrop State Park, for instance, before heading back into town to relax. Or, for the real thrill seekers, you can soak in the views from high in the sky as you zip across the treetops on one of five dual zip lines at Zip Lost Pines. You can even book their sunset or nighttime zip tours to experience the rush after dark!

Copper Shot Distillery

Copper Shot aims to produce great spirits — in more ways than one! Their meticulously crafted drinks are sure to leave you smiling wider than you were when you came in. Located right in Downtown Bastrop, Copper Shot Distillery serves up handcrafted, small-batch spirits made with locally sourced ingredients, giving visitors the chance to taste their way through some of Bastrop’s best alcoholic offerings. You can even take a tour of the distillery to learn about the production process, which ends with a sampling of their signature spirits. Or, for a more casual visit, lounge in their tasting room with a unique craft cocktail and catch some live music.

Bastrop Beer Company

Bastrop Beer Company

Any fans of craft beer would be remiss in missing a visit to Bastrop Beer Company. Whether you’re looking to settle down and stay awhile or you’re just after something to sip while you stroll through Downtown Bastrop, this locally favored beer and bottle shop has you covered. Choose from 28 beers on draft, or from the hundreds of bottles and cans available for purchase. No matter what you choose, you can’t go wrong. For the competitive types, you can enjoy your drink alongside a game of pool or pinball in their cushy lounge area. 

Rising Sun Vineyard

Located a short drive from Bastrop, Rising Sun Vineyard is Texas’s little piece of heaven. Here, you can soak in breathtaking vineyard views as you serenely sip handcrafted wines unique to the region. They offer guided tours of the vineyard, so those curious can learn about the winemaking process as you savor your sips. On Saturdays, they also offer live music under their covered pavilion. Our recommendation? Book an early evening tasting so you can catch the sunset over the vineyard, then dance the night away with some local talent as your guide.

Kana Wine Tasting Lounge

This cozy downtown tasting lounge is a great spot to pop in for a wine break in between all your shopping and exploring. Their signature lounge tasting is only $18 per person, and worth every cent. Taste your way through five different luxurious wines and learn more about the Bastrop winemaking culture. Afterward, pick up a bottle to take home. Kana Wine also hosts a variety of events, so depending on when you visit, you might be able to take an interactive class, such as Sushi 101 on March 27th, which will teach you how to make your own sushi at home.
